En son web geliştirme öğreticiler
 

HTML DOM length Propery

<Özellik Nesne

Örnek

Bir niteliklerini sayısını al <button> elemanı:

var x = document.getElementsByTagName("BUTTON")[0].attributes.length;

X'in sonucu olabilir:

2
Kendin dene "

Daha "Try it Yourself" Aşağıdaki örnekler.


Tanımı ve Kullanımı

uzunluk tesisinde NamedNodeMap nesnesindeki düğümlerin sayısını verir.

Bir Düğüm nesne nitelikleri bir NamedNodeMap nesnesinin bir örnektir.

Bu özellik salt okunur.

İpucu: kullan item() Bir NamedNodeMap nesnesinde belirtilen dizine bir düğüm dönmek için yöntem.


Tarayıcı Desteği

özellik
length Evet Evet Evet Evet Evet

Not: Internet Explorer 8 ve öncesinde, özellikler için length özelliği bir öğe için olası tüm niteliklerin sayısını döndürür.


Sözdizimi

namednodemap .length

Teknik detaylar

Geri dönüş değeri: nodemap öznitelik düğümlerin sayısını temsil eden bir sayı,
DOM Sürüm Çekirdek Seviye 1

Örnekler

Diğer Örnekler

Örnek

Bir bütün nitelikleri aracılığıyla Döngü <button> elemanı ve çıkış Her özelliğin adı:

var txt = "";
var x = document.getElementById("myBtn").attributes;

var i;
for (i = 0; i < x.length; i++) {
    txt += "Attribute name: " + x[i].name + "<br>";
}

Txt sonucu olacaktır:

Attribute name: id
Attribute name: onclick
Attribute name: class
Kendin dene "

Örnek

Bir nitelikleri kaç öğrenin <img> var eleman:

var x = document.getElementById("myImg").attributes.length;

X'in sonucu olacaktır:

5
Kendin dene "

Örnek

Bir bütün nitelikleri aracılığıyla Döngü <img> elemanı ve çıkış her özelliğin adı ve değeri:

var txt = "";
var x = document.getElementById("myImg");

var i;
for (i = 0; i < x.attributes.length; i++) {
    txt = txt + x.attributes[i].name + " = " + x.attributes[i].value + "<br>";
}
Kendin dene "

<Özellik Nesne